目录一、MyBatis+MyBatis-Plus:第一步:将UserMapper继承BaseMapper第二步:使用MyBatisPlus的MybatisSqlSessionFactoryBuilder进程构建:第三步:在实体类上添加@TableName,指定数据库表名:简单说明:二、Spring+MyBatis+MyBatisPlus:创建项目导入依赖:编写数据库配置文件:第一步:编写jdbc.
转载
2024-10-07 13:34:58
332阅读
# 教你如何实现MyBatisPlus整合HBase
## 一、整体流程
首先我们来看一下整个实现的流程,可以用表格展示如下:
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 配置Maven依赖 |
| 2 | 配置HBase |
| 3 | 创建HBase表 |
| 4 | 创建实体类 |
| 5 | 创建Mapper接口 |
| 6 | 创建Service接口及实现类
原创
2024-06-05 06:25:59
139阅读
## 使用MyBatisPlus执行MySQL中的find_in_set函数
在实际的开发中,我们经常会遇到需要在数据库中查询包含某个特定值的字段的情况。MySQL中提供了`find_in_set`函数来实现这一功能。而在使用Java开发过程中,我们可以结合MyBatisPlus来操作数据库,方便快捷地实现这一查询需求。
### 什么是find_in_set函数
`find_in_set`函
原创
2024-07-14 03:19:51
297阅读
一、配置添加 SpringBoot 启动器依赖<dependency>
<groupId>com.baomidou</groupId>
<artifactId>mybatis-plus-boot-starter</artifactId>
<version>3.4.2</version&
转载
2024-05-28 16:13:59
29阅读
JPA、Hibernate和Mybatis一、JPA、Hibernate和Mybatis的介绍JPA:Java Persistence API.JPA通过JDK 5.0注解-关系表的映射关系,并将运行期的实体对象持久化到数据库中。JPA是JavaEE中的标准。JPA标准只提供了一套规范,需要有JPA的具体实现,Hibernate实现了JPA2.0标准,所以我们在用JPA的时候,其实用的是Hiber
转载
2024-02-24 17:24:52
42阅读
前言:介绍一个简单的MyBatis加解密方式,日常学习工作中提及这种方法的比较少,所以拿来说说,如果已经知道这种方法的忽略本文!一、背景在我们数据库中有些时候会保存一些用户的敏感信息,比如:手机号、银行卡等信息,如果这些信息以明文的方式保存,那么是不安全的。假如:黑客黑进了数据库,或者离职人员导出了数据,那么就可能导致这些敏感数据的泄漏。因此我们就需要找到一种方法来解决这个问题。二、解决方案由于我
转载
2023-11-19 12:50:30
861阅读
SpringBoot开发规范通用模板1 分页插件使用通过MybatisPlus配置分页插件拦截器@Configuration
@MapperScan("com.xuecheng.content.mapper") //拦截的mapper层
public class MybatisPlusConfig {
//定义分页的拦截器
@Bean
public MybatisPlu
文章目录添加配置类测试分页XML自定义分页MyBatis Plus自带分页插件,只要简单的配置即可实现分页功能添加配置类package com.zyd.config;import com.baomidou.mybatisplus.annotation.DbType;import com.baomidou.mybatisplus.extension.plugins.MybatisPlu
原创
2022-01-24 16:19:13
2607阅读
1.新建一个maven的project2.导入依赖3.在src下新建Generator类,并执行main方法即完成基础代码生成javaimportcom.baomidou.mybatisplus.annotation.DbType;importcom.baomidou.mybatisplus.generator.AutoGenerator;importcom.baomidou.mybatisplu
原创
2021-10-01 00:10:28
796阅读
点赞
目录基于SpringBoot使用MyBatisPlus标准数据层开发Lombok分页功能DQL编程控制构建条件查询null判定查询投影聚合查询分组查询查询条件模糊查询排序查询映射匹配兼容性DML编程控制id生成策略控制雪花算法:简化配置多记录操作逻辑删除编辑乐观锁快速开发 MybatisPlu
MyBatis-Plus(简称 MP)是一个MyBatis的增强工具,在MyBatis的基础上只做增强不做改变,为简化开发、提高效率而生。
一、项目案例简介1、多数据简介实际的项目中,经常会用到不同的数据库以满足项目的实际需求。随着业务的并发量的不断增加,一个项目使用多个数据库:主从复制、读写分离、分布式数据库等方式,越来越常见。2、MybatisPlu
JAVA婚恋交友系统源码:多端融合的智能婚恋社交解决方案一、市场需求分析与行业背景中国单身人口规模已突破2.4亿(2025年最新统计数据),婚恋社交行业迎来数字化升级的关键窗口期。然而,传统婚恋平台存在三大核心痛点:信息真实性难保障(虚假资料投诉占比达32%)、匹配精准度低(平均需互动68次才能达成线下见面)、用户粘性不足(次月留存率普遍低于35%)。基于SpringBoot+MyBatisPlu
一、需求在设计数据库的时候每条数据基本上包含这么几个字段:主键ID,状态、创建者、创建时间、修改者、修改时间、是否逻辑删除......每个实体类都包含这么几个相同的的字段的话显得有点冗余,操作数据也不方便,所以新建个所有实体类的父类来专门处理这些相同的字段就显得非常必要,这样每个实体类继承它就可以了不用每个都包含这些相同的字段了。二、例子import com.baomidou.mybatisplu